dae
Violet Hour Purple Shampoo
Highly rated by customers for: , ,
$32.00get it for $30.40 (5% off) with Auto-Replenishor 4 payments of $8.00 with or or
Size: 10 oz / 300 mL
Standard size
Highly rated by customers for: , ,
$32.00get it for $30.40 (5% off) with Auto-Replenishor 4 payments of $8.00 with or or
Standard size